China's MIIT Targets 9,800 EFLOPS by 2030, RMB 3.8 Trillion Investment
China's Ministry of Industry and Information Technology proposed in the 15th Five-Year Plan for the information and communications industry that intelligent computing power reach 9,800 EFLOPS by 2030. The plan specifies information infrastructure investment of RMB 3.8 trillion from 2026 to 2030 and the construction of computing clusters with 10,000 or more accelerator cards per cluster, with some clusters reaching 100,000 or more accelerator cards.
As of the end of June 2026, China's intelligent computing power was 2,185 EFLOPS, up 177% year on year. The country had 52 facilities with more than 10,000 accelerator cards.
